Dr Nauman Niaz apologizes to Shoaib Akhtar after facing backlash

Dr. Nauman Niaz has presented an apology to former cricketer Shoaib Akhtar after he faced a serious backlash from the public for insulting him during a live show.

On Thursday, in a statement on YouTube channel, Dr. Nauman, PTV’s host said, “I apologized thousands of times over my conduct.” He further added, “Whatever the reason, I had no right to do all this on-air, it was my fault. Shoaib Akhtar is a star and I love his cricket.”

Moreover, Dr. Niaz further mentioned that after the show his father also condemned him for his behavior. He further admits that, it was rude behavior and he should have handled the situation in another way. Niaz said that, “It shouldn’t have happened. I’m ready to pay the price and am paying.”

Meanwhile, after facing a serious backlash for insulting a cricket legend Dr. Nauman Niaz was barred from hosting the PTV Sports’ programme ‘Game On Hai’.

The incident

The altercation between Akhtar and Niaz had taken place during a post-match analysis after Pakistan’s win against New Zealand in a T20 World Cup fixture on Tuesday. The two were part of a panel for PTV Sports’ programme ‘Game On Hai’.

During a discussion on the Pakistan squad, Akhtar had credited the Pakistan Super League’s (PSL) Lahore Qalandars franchise for discovering Shaheen Shah Afridi and Haris Rauf.

Niaz, however, had taken issue with Akhtar’s comments and said, “You are being a little rude so I don’t want to say this but if you’re being over-smart then you can go. I am saying this on air.”

Once the show had resumed after a break, Akhtar had apologized to the guests on the panel and announced his resignation from PTV, saying he could not continue with the programme because of “how I was treated on national television”.

The episode had caused an uproar on social media with politicians, journalists, and media persons coming to the former cricketer’s defense and criticizing Niaz for his behavior.
